About

How much are we Robin Hood and do we want to be? What weapons are allowed for a just cause? And what is just at all? Where does our complex world today go beyond the scope of our template?

"Robin and the Hoods" tackles questions of birthright, distribution and justice with the King of Thieves - Robin Hood - at its back. Playfully, with electropunk music and dancing in tights, pulk fiction test the rebellion for people 8 years and older. They set out on the trail of its historical reality and, without moralistic pointing fingers, negotiate the burning question of how a just life can be achieved for all. And with how much emphasis people can, must, should, may, want to stand up for their ideas and convictions so that they are heard.

pulk fiktion is a performance group founded in 2007 and based in Cologne. A heterogeneous group of artists from the fields of theater, film, music, performance, video art and interactive media works in different constellations on productions for children, young people and adults.
